Top definition
Swag! Your active, and attractive. Magnetic in energy and stimulates those around you. Inspiring and motivating. Restless nature demands action and you dislike system and monotony.

As you are versatile and capable, you could do any job well, although you would not like to do menial tasks.

Having considerable vision, you could be adept at formulating new, more effective ways of doing things; in a charming non intrusive way.

Poster child of success!

You could organize the work of others, though in your impatience to see the job done efficiently, you would likely step right in and do it yourself.

Very present and have the ability to master and manifest what you think of. Positive and tenacious, nothing stops you from your ultimate goal.
Who's that girl?

That's Shenni! 'Nuff Said!

You remind me of Shenni!

You are such a Shenni, it's amazing!

Shenni me, master!
by Quasar Mastermind December 05, 2011
Get the mug
Get a Shenni mug for your friend Abdul.
A Shen Ni is a girl that is really funny and fun to talk to. A Shen Ni may be shy at first but once you get to know a Shen Ni, you can't shut her up
She' so funny! She must be a Shen Ni
by kthuei November 24, 2010
Get the mug
Get a Shen Ni mug for your fish Callisto.
The revolutionary act of taking a sneaky dump in the middle of a tennis court late at night. Made popular by Anthony Hopkins in Swansea, 1992.
Anthony Hopkins: "I played a superb singles game of 'Les Dennis' last night on centre court."

Jodie Foster: "Is that your British rhyming slang for 'shennis'?"

Hopkins: "Yeah it is! It's exciting"

Foster: "Yeah I LOVE shennis!"
by noamshouseparty July 07, 2009
Get the mug
Get a Shennis mug for your boyfriend Paul.